For a commercial landlord or property manager, the lobby is the product. Tenants and their guests judge a building by how the front desk feels — and by whether the building can be trusted to know who is inside. A paper logbook signals neither security nor quality.
What tenants and guests expect
- A fast, professional welcome — not a queue at a clipboard.
- Their host notified instantly on arrival.
- Confidence that the building controls access properly.
- Privacy — one guest's details not on show to the next.
What the operator needs
Behind the experience, the operator needs consistency across the portfolio, a building-wide view for safety, and per-tenant separation — the multi-tenant balance of giving each occupier its own flow while keeping one picture of the building.
Security as a selling point
Restricted Visitor screening — see blocking barred individuals — a clean audit trail and controlled access are not just risk controls; in a competitive leasing market they are amenities that help win and keep tenants.
